Are there any online platforms that offer tax assistance for cryptocurrency investors?

I'm a cryptocurrency investor and I'm wondering if there are any online platforms that can help me with tax assistance. Are there any reliable platforms that specialize in providing tax guidance and support specifically for cryptocurrency investors?

6 answers
- Absolutely! There are several online platforms that offer tax assistance for cryptocurrency investors. One popular platform is CoinTracker. CoinTracker is a user-friendly platform that helps you calculate your cryptocurrency taxes, generate tax forms, and even integrates with popular exchanges and wallets to automatically import your transaction data. It's a great tool for simplifying the tax reporting process and ensuring compliance with tax regulations.

- Yes, there are online platforms that specialize in providing tax assistance for cryptocurrency investors. One such platform is CryptoTrader.Tax. CryptoTrader.Tax offers a simple and automated way to calculate your cryptocurrency taxes. You can import your transaction history from exchanges, generate tax reports, and even get guidance on how to properly report your cryptocurrency gains and losses. It's a convenient solution for those who want to ensure accurate tax reporting without the hassle.

- Definitely! There are online platforms that cater specifically to cryptocurrency investors and offer tax assistance. One such platform is TaxBit. TaxBit provides a range of tax services for cryptocurrency investors, including tax calculations, reporting, and even audit support. With TaxBit, you can easily import your transaction data from exchanges, calculate your gains and losses, and generate accurate tax reports. It's a trusted platform that simplifies the tax reporting process for cryptocurrency investors.

- Yes, there are online platforms that specialize in tax assistance for cryptocurrency investors. One platform worth mentioning is CoinTracking. CoinTracking offers a comprehensive suite of tools for tracking and managing your cryptocurrency portfolio, including tax reporting features. With CoinTracking, you can import your trades from various exchanges, calculate your tax liabilities, and generate detailed tax reports. It's a reliable platform that helps cryptocurrency investors stay compliant with tax regulations.

- Absolutely! There are online platforms that specifically cater to cryptocurrency investors and provide tax assistance. One such platform is TokenTax. TokenTax offers a user-friendly interface for importing your cryptocurrency transactions, calculating your tax liabilities, and generating tax reports. It also provides guidance on tax optimization strategies and supports various tax scenarios, including mining, staking, and DeFi activities. It's a great platform for simplifying the tax reporting process and ensuring accurate tax compliance.
